**Vendor note: Inkmill markdown pipeline**

Rendering for Parchway docs is outsourced to Inkmill under an annual contract, renewing each March. They handle sanitization and PDF export; we own the upload queue. SLA: 4-hour response on rendering failures. Escalate only after two failed retries. Their support desk is reachable at the address below.

billing contact of hahaf-baguf = zorael.tammir.jorius@sivrelhq.internal

### Checklist item 7: Archive cold storage buckets

Before cutting the Frostvault release, archive all cold storage buckets older than 180 days. Confirm each bucket's retention manifest matches the archival policy, then run the archive job in dry-run mode and review the summary for unexpected deletions. Only after sign-off from the data steward should you execute the live pass. Record the completion in the release log. Paste the archive job's build token immediately under the line that follows this sentence.

build token for kagaf-hahof: htk14_9d3d4d26d7d8de

Action item from the Tidemark incident review: stand up a schema registry for all event producers before the next release train. Producers must register schemas and pass compatibility checks in CI; unregistered events get rejected at the gateway. Owner: platform team, due end of quarter. The rollout plan and cutover dates are documented on the internal page below.

wiki page, hahif-hahif: https://argocd.kelvisys.corp/browse/board/settings/pages/1442e0b1065d83f1